Power Management IC’s Market: Trends, Growth, and Future Prospects

The Power Management IC’s Market is witnessing rapid growth as electronic devices continue to demand more efficient power solutions. These integrated circuits are critical for regulating voltage, managing battery performance, and optimizing energy consumption in a variety of applications, including smartphones, wearable devices, automotive electronics, and industrial equipment. With rising adoption of energy-efficient technologies, the market for power management ICs is projected to expand significantly in the coming years.

FAQs

Q1: What is a power management IC?
A power management IC (PMIC) is a device that manages power requirements for electronic systems, including voltage regulation, battery management, and energy-efficient power distribution.

Q2: What are the key applications of power management ICs?
PMICs are widely used in smartphones, laptops, automotive electronics, industrial machinery, IoT devices, and energy-efficient consumer electronics.

Q3: How does the growth of IoT influence the power management IC market?
The expansion of IoT devices increases demand for compact, efficient, and multifunctional PMICs that optimize battery life and energy consumption in connected devices.
